Plugin authors: every release of the Fernwhistle feed validator ships with signed provenance so you can verify which ruleset compiled your results. Check the manifest before reporting discrepancies, since stale local caches are the usual culprit. Validation output always embeds the producing build's token, and the one for the current stable release follows here.

pipeline stamp: htk9_ce63042d9

## Authentication

Heads up: the nightly reindex job (`reindex_nightly.py`) talks to the Lanternfish search cluster, and that cluster won't accept anonymous writes anymore — we locked it down last sprint. The job now authenticates as the `reindex-runner` service identity against Corvid Gateway, and the token is injected via the `LF_INDEX_TOKEN` env var in the scheduler config. Nothing clever going on, just a bearer header on every batch request. For review purposes, the staging credential currently in use is listed below.

service key, kadug-kadup: kto15_rN23XLAYImmZgrJ

Subject: Restock planner — getting started

Hi,

Quick onboarding notes for the Vendaroo restock planner integration. Planner API lives in the partner sandbox. Submit machine fill levels to /restock/plan; response includes route order and suggested quantities. Rate limit is 60 requests/min. Errors return standard problem JSON. Docs are on the partner wiki.

For sandbox calls, use the token below.

session JWT of yawep-yawep = eyJhbGciOiJIUzI1NiIsInR5cCI6IkpXVCJ9.eyJzdWIiOiI3pWF3_In0.aXYsHiog